State Inspection History

State Inspections

Source: PA State Licensing Agency

28total
46deficiencies

Key Findings

Between 2020 and 2025, Cathedral Village underwent 28 inspections, resulting in 9 clean reports and 46 recorded violations. Findings from these inspections included issues regarding staff training documentation, fire safety protocols, and resident assessment procedures.

Aug 7, 2025Routine
minor2600.51

Staff person A did not have a PA Patch criminal background check in their file.

minor2600.103.c

Four 5-gallon containers of ice cream in the dining room freezer did not have lids securely closed.

minor2600.103.e

An unlabeled and undated plate of sausage, bacon, and potatoes was found in the personal care kitchen microwave.

minor2600.171.b

Staff members B and C were transporting residents to medical appointments without having completed required initial new hire direct care staff training.

minor2600.181.f

A resident's record did not include a current list of medications that were present in the resident's room.

Feb 27, 2025Routine
minor2600.23a

A resident's support plan required assistance with eating due to poor vision, but staff failed to provide the required assistance with an evening snack.

minor2600.42c

A staff member yelled loudly at a resident during a verbal altercation, failing to treat the resident with dignity and respect.

minor2600.227e

A resident's support plan incorrectly documented their ability to self-administer medications, contradicting their medical evaluation.

Mar 15, 2023Routine
minor2600.132.e

The facility failed to conduct a fire drill during sleeping hours within the required 6-month timeframe.

minor2600.185.a

Discrepancies were noted between glucometer readings and the documentation recorded on the Medication Administration Record.

Apr 20, 2022Routine
minor2600.66.b

The staff training plan does not include training on memory support, which is necessary for residents with dementia diagnoses.

minor2600.85.a

An injection pen for a resident was not properly stored and had a smear of blood on it.

minor2600.132.f

Only the main lobby exit route was used during fire drills conducted between January and March 2022.

minor2600.141.a

A resident's medical evaluation was missing information regarding general physical examination, immunization history, and special health or dietary needs.

minor2600.185.a

A prescribed PRN medication was not available in the home at the time of inspection.

Dec 10, 2021Routine
minor2600.16d

The home failed to submit a final incident report to the Department following the initial report submitted on November 30, 2021.

Oct 13, 2021Routine
minor2600.185.a

Discrepancies were noted between glucometer readings and the Medication Administration Record (MAR), and some readings were left undocumented.

Jul 1, 2021Routine
minor2600.123b

The home's posted emergency procedures did not include the emergency procedures of the local municipality.

Jun 14, 2021Routine
minor2600.28f

The home failed to provide a required refund to a resident within 30 days of their discharge.

minor2600.162c

Weekly menus for the weeks of June 14 and June 21, 2021, were not posted in a conspicuous and public place.

minor2600.181d

Several medications, including Clonazepam and Pantoprazole, were found unlocked and unattended in a resident's bedroom.

minor2600.187d

The home failed to follow prescriber orders when a resident was administered 1 mg of Clonazepam instead of the prescribed 0.5 mg.
